/* Test file created by Linas Vepstas <linas@linas.org>
* Try to create duplicate GncGUID's, which should never happen.
*
*/
#include <guid.hpp>
#include <glib.h>
extern "C"
{
#include <config.h>
#include <ctype.h>
#include "cashobjects.h"
#include "test-stuff.h"
#include "test-engine-stuff.h"
#include "qof.h"
}
#define NENT 50123
static void test_null_guid(void)
{
GncGUID g;
GncGUID *gp;
g = guid_new_return();
gp = guid_new();
do_test(guid_equal(guid_null(), guid_null()), "null guids equal");
do_test(!guid_equal(&g, gp), "two guids equal");
guid_free(gp);
}
static void
run_test (void)
{
int i;
QofSession *sess;
QofBook *book;
QofInstance *ent;
QofCollection *col;
QofIdType type;
GncGUID guid;
sess = get_random_session ();
book = qof_session_get_book (sess);
do_test ((NULL != book), "book not created");
col = qof_book_get_collection (book, "asdf");
type = qof_collection_get_type (col);
for (i = 0; i < NENT; i++)
{
ent = static_cast<QofInstance*>(g_object_new(QOF_TYPE_INSTANCE, NULL));
guid_replace(&guid);
ent = static_cast<QofInstance*>(g_object_new(QOF_TYPE_INSTANCE,
"guid", &guid, NULL));
do_test ((NULL == qof_collection_lookup_entity (col, &guid)),
"duplicate guid");
ent->e_type = type;
qof_collection_insert_entity (col, ent);
do_test ((NULL != qof_collection_lookup_entity (col, &guid)),
"guid not found");
}
/* Make valgrind happy -- destroy the session. */
qof_session_destroy(sess);
}
int
main (int argc, char **argv)
{
qof_init();
if (cashobjects_register())
{
test_null_guid();
run_test ();
print_test_results();
}
qof_close();
return get_rv();
}
